Description: Tubed CD player with digital inputs. Tube complement: two PCC88 (6DJ8) or ECC88 (7DJ8). Digital inputs: 2 S/PDIF (RCA, TosLink), 1 USB. Analog outputs: 1 single-ended (RCA), 1 balanced (XLR), 1 headphone. Maximum output: 5V. Signal/noise: 95dB. Total harmonic distortion: 0.5%.
Dimensions: 17.1" (435mm) W by 2.6" (65mm) H by 11.2" (285mm) D. Weight: 17.6 lbs (8kg).
Finish: Black with polished chrome faceplate.
Serial number of unit reviewed: 615-002-A550.
Price: $6795. Approximate number of dealers: Not disclosed. Warranty: 1 year.…

I measured the EAR Acute Classic with my Audio Precision SYS2722 system (see the January 2008 "As We See It"). As well as the Audio Precision's optical and coaxial S/PDIF outputs, I used WAV and AIFF test-tone files sourced via USB from my MacBook Pro running on battery power with Pure Music 3.0. Apple's USB Prober utility identified the EAR DAC as "xCORE USB Audio 2.0" from "XMOS" and confirmed that its USB port operated in the optimal isochronous asynchronous mode. Description: Three-way, ported, floorstanding loudspeaker. Drive-units: 2"-high planar-magnetic tweeter, 4" plastic-cone mid/bass driver, 5.5" down-firing paper-cone woofer. Crossover frequencies: 80Hz, 5kHz. Frequency range: 33Hz–22kHz. Sensitivity: 86dB/W/m. Nominal impedance: 4 ohms.
Dimensions: 17.6" (450mm) H by 7.8" (200mm) W by 6.25" (160mm) D. Weight: 15 lbs (6.8kg).
Finishes: American Walnut, Natural Oak, Black Oak, Satin White; others on request.
Serial numbers of units reviewed: IA160015A & B.

I used DRA Labs' MLSSA system and a calibrated DPA 4006 microphone to measure the NEAT Acoustics Iota Alpha's frequency response in the farfield, and an Earthworks QTC-40 for the nearfield responses. The first challenge I faced was deciding on which axis I should place my microphone for the farfield measurements. Sitting on its spikes, the Iota Alpha is 19" high, and its tweeter is just 17" from the floor.
